Key Responsibilities
Assist Project Managers with day-to-day oversight of jobsite operations, schedules, and financial tracking.
Support pre-construction efforts, including subcontractor coordination, bid reviews, and procurement logistics.
Track project quantities, daily production rates, labor hours, and change order impacts.
Work collaboratively with superintendents and field teams to identify and solve technical and logistical challenges.
Maintain comprehensive project documentation: RFIs, submittals, meeting notes, progress reports, and logs.
Ensure adherence to project specifications, safety standards, and internal processes.
Foster professional relationships with clients, subcontractors, engineers, and vendors.
Contribute to project closeout activities, including punch list tracking, final inspections, and document turnover.
Qualifications
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, or a related field preferred (equivalent experience considered).
1-3 years of hands‑on experience in civil construction (highway, utility, or infrastructure focus).
Understanding of construction documents, schedules, cost control, and contracts.
Strong pro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ite; experience with tools like Vista, B2W, Primavera P6, HCSS, or Procore is a plus.
Excellent communication, documentation, and multitasking skills.
Strong commitment to jobsite safety and construction quality.
